Deltares study highlights the advantages of broad green dikes

A study carried out by Delft based independent research institute Deltares and Alterra Wageningen University and Research Centre has examined an alternative option for upgrading dikes along the Eems-Dollard area.

The advantages of broad green dikes in the Netherlands are being highlighted (Deltares)

The study looked at various options for upgrading the dikes including the broad green dike model, comparing the construction costs and protection levels with a traditional dike. The adoption of a broad green dike has often been used in the Netherlands for flood control measures in the past, featuring a very shallow slope and a foreland consisting of marshland.

The dike is built entirely from clay and covered with grass. Natural features are included in the design, intended to generate interest from nature conservation organisations and local residents. As mentioned, this approach to building dikes has been adopted previously but generally they are no longer considered as an alternative as there is a preference nowadays for dikes that take up as little space as possible making such options inappropriate at locations where space is at a premium.

The Eems-Dollard area however is considered to be suitable for this type of dike. The cost per kilometre of a broad green dike is significantly lower as there are no requirements for an expensive asphalt or stone revetment. This finding came as somewhat of a surprise to the researchers because more material is actually required for the dike. The dike also has advantages over traditional forms in terms of safety. The larger base width of the dike, in combination with the marsh making it less susceptible to seepage and piping; mechanisms that render dikes unstable.

In addition, the crest of the dike does not need to be as high with consequential improvements in stability. The favourable results of the comparison study have led to the researchers recommending small-scale tests over the next few years for the new dike concept and the extraction of clay from the marshland. These tests are expected to generate additional information making it possible to consider the option of broad green dikes as a potential alternative during the next round of dike upgrades.

The ‘Detailed exploration of a green Dollard dike’ study was produced as part of the national government’s Wadden Area Delta Programme in collaboration with Rijkwaterstraat’s corporate innovation programme, the rich Wadden Sea programme and the Rural Area Department (Dienst Landelijk Gebied). The study was initiated in response to the rejection of a number of dikes in the northern Netherlands because the hard revetments were no longer able to cope with the waves.
